Mockingjay 1-100
Everyone decides that Katniss is finally well enough to be taken to the ruins of District Twelve. She walks around her former town looking in awe. As she made her way around town, she would see the remains of people, some still decomposing and others not. Several skulls and bones were lying in the pathway of the road. Gale, that was in the hovercraft protecting her, told her that it was probably time to go. They left and went to the "no longer existing" District Thirteen. Once they arrived, they went into the ground to see the housing. There was no window to stare out of whatsoever. Katniss is tired of living like this. They have to ration their food, get a schedule printed on their forearm, and can't even leave the perimeter of the fence. Katniss talked to the president of the district about leaving it hunt, after she agreed to be the Mockingjay. The president decided to let Katniss go to District Eight where there shouldn't be anymore bombing for awhile. She went there with several bodyguards that also included Gale and Boggs. She visited all of the sick or injured people kept in the hospital. All of the people were happy and yet surprised to see her. When it was time for her to leave, several planes from the Capital came and started bombing the hospital, trying to kill the injured so they don't get well again. Katniss, Gale, and Boggs made their way over to a blue building. Katniss and Gale noticed that there were guns on top of an adjacent building. They climbed up there to start shooting. They didn't really know how to work the guns that well, so they use their arrows that Beetee had made fort them. Several of the planes were shot down, then some of the remaining ones left. After they climbed back down, the camera crew was taping Katniss' reaction to the whole situation. Katniss yelled at President Snow as a plane was falling and she told him, "Fire is catching! And if we burn, you will burn with us!"
